Публикации по теме 'destructuring'
Что такое деструктуризация в JavaScript?
Деструктуризация в JavaScript означает копирование значений массива или свойств объекта в переменную.
Деструктуризация не означает разрушения. Это не так, потому что массив или объект, из которого вы можете скопировать значения, не изменяется. Это выражение JavaScript появилось в ECMAScript 2015/16.
В этой статье вы узнаете, как деструктурировать значения в массиве, свойства объекта и другие способы деструктуризации.
Базовая деструктуризация в массивах
Деструктуризация упрощает..
Привязки блоков ES6, функции, деструктуризация и классы
День 5 изучения JavaScript — этап 1
Эта статья написана немного на основе учебника Leanpub — Understanding ES6 . Для получения дополнительных объяснений и примеров, не стесняйтесь посетить веб-сайт.
1. Блочные привязки: замените IIFE, используя «let».
Мы можем заменить IIFE и получить тот же результат, объявив let внутри цикла. В блочной привязке для более чистого кода мы можем использовать let вместо var, в отличие от IIFE. Что делает IIFE, так это объявляет переменную..
Вопросы по теме 'destructuring'
Ошибка TSLint для деструктуризации в параметрах функции
Я хотел бы удалить ошибку tslint, которую я получаю при следующем (в параметре разрушения объекта):
export function renameProperty(
oldProp: string,
newProp: string,
{[oldProp]: old, ...others}
): any {
return {
[newProp]:...
193 просмотров
schedule
16.01.2024
Изменить тип данных при деструктуризации
Возьмите следующий код:
nums = ["1", "2", "3"]
one, two, three = nums
print("Sum:", one+two+three) # >> Sum: 123
Есть ли способ изменить тип данных строк при деструктурировании? Я надеялся, что сработает что-то вроде следующего, но, к...
132 просмотров
schedule
27.10.2023